Missing boy woke up outside Perth home

A boy who went missing in a stolen car in Perth has been found safe. (AAP)

A seven-year-old boy woke up unharmed outside a Perth home after a carjacker stole an SUV with him inside it.

The boy was inside the Mitsubishi Pajero Sport when it was stolen from Napier Street in Morley in the city's northeast on Saturday night.

The car owner's son was inside the vehicle at the time, with the incident sparking an urgent police search and social media campaign to find him.

WA Police confirmed the boy woke up in the back of the SUV on Sunday morning.

The car was mysteriously parked at a Forrestfield home and the child spoke to an occupant who promptly called police.

The boy was picked up by officers and taken to the local station where he was reunited with his mother "safe and well", WA Police said.

Police will investigate the theft of the vehicle and how it came to be parked at the home, with anyone who saw the SUV in Morley or Forrestfield urged to contact Crime Stoppers.
